Q: How do I make an avatar or sig fall within the memory size limit?
A: Open your picture using a photo editing program; This includes but is not limited to:
Photoshop
The Gimp
Irfan Viewer
Take your picture and open it with one of these programs. The Gimp and Photoshop let you create and resize while Irfan Viewer is only a viewer but is good if you just want to quickly resize images.
After it is open go ahead and do a File > Save As
The program should now let you choose the quality. It will probably say save between 0-100% quality usually on a sliding tool. The Gimp allows you to also check the file size as you raise and lower image quality.
See below for a screen shot from The Gimp. Notice above the Sig it says 400 x 100. Also, notice that due to this size I have to save the file at 70% quality (not good) in order to get it below 12.0 KB.

Q: How do I make an Avatar.
A: Basically Av's are the little pictures in the left hand corner right under your "Username" or "Handle". You make them the same as you make sigs..Except they are much smaller.
Under 6 kb's total and 80h x 80w. An easy way to make one is to download Irfan Viewer which is free. Then take your favorite picture and just simply do a Scale Image as seen below using IRFAN VIEWER...Different programs have different options but its usually called Scale or Resize.
Next set it to 80 x 80 pixels and make sure that it lets you change the height and width seperately..Notice the perserve aspect ratio check box...This means if you change a 120h x 60w image to 60h it will automatically make it a 30w. Don't check this usually. Sometimes this will be symbolized by a chain, for locked aspect, or a broken chain to signify that you may change it however you like it. Check below.
